In World of Warcraft, RNG refers to the chance at which certain events or abilities happen, such as item drops in quests or blocks/parries during combat. RNG In Speed Running Speed Running a game is a technical term used by gamers which means to finish playing a game as fast as possible. These gamers practice hard to beat the game, but RNG always creates an element of surprise which can delay in ending the game.

Even given a source of plausible random numbers perhaps from a quantum mechanically based hardware generator , obtaining numbers which are completely unbiased takes care.
In addition, behavior of these generators often changes with temperature, power supply voltage, the age of the device, or other outside interference.
And a software bug in a pseudo-random number routine, or a hardware bug in the hardware it runs on, may be similarly difficult to detect.
Generated random numbers are sometimes subjected to statistical tests before use to ensure that the underlying source is still working, and then post-processed to improve their statistical properties.
An example would be the TRNG [15] hardware random number generator, which uses an entropy measurement as a hardware test, and then post-processes the random sequence with a shift register stream cipher.
It is generally hard to use statistical tests to validate the generated random numbers. Wang and Nicol [16] proposed a distance-based statistical testing technique that is used to identify the weaknesses of several random generators.
Li and Wang [17] proposed a method of testing random numbers based on laser chaotic entropy sources using Brownian motion properties.
Random numbers uniformly distributed between 0 and 1 can be used to generate random numbers of any desired distribution by passing them through the inverse cumulative distribution function CDF of the desired distribution see Inverse transform sampling.
Inverse CDFs are also called quantile functions. This is referred to as software whitening. Computational and hardware random number generators are sometimes combined to reflect the benefits of both kinds.
Computational random number generators can typically generate pseudo-random numbers much faster than physical generators, while physical generators can generate "true randomness.
Some computations making use of a random number generator can be summarized as the computation of a total or average value, such as the computation of integrals by the Monte Carlo method.
For such problems, it may be possible to find a more accurate solution by the use of so-called low-discrepancy sequences , also called quasirandom numbers.
Such sequences have a definite pattern that fills in gaps evenly, qualitatively speaking; a truly random sequence may, and usually does, leave larger gaps.
Since much cryptography depends on a cryptographically secure random number generator for key and cryptographic nonce generation, if a random number generator can be made predictable, it can be used as backdoor by an attacker to break the encryption.
If for example an SSL connection is created using this random number generator, then according to Matthew Green it would allow NSA to determine the state of the random number generator, and thereby eventually be able to read all data sent over the SSL connection.
RSA has denied knowingly inserting a backdoor into its products. It has also been theorized that hardware RNGs could be secretly modified to have less entropy than stated, which would make encryption using the hardware RNG susceptible to attack.
One such method which has been published works by modifying the dopant mask of the chip, which would be undetectable to optical reverse-engineering.
